🤖 What Is Abi—and What Does It Do?

Abi is an AI-driven robotic companion built specifically for elderly care.

It’s designed to:

  • Hold conversations
  • Remind users about medication
  • Provide emotional companionship
  • Monitor well-being
  • Assist with daily routines

⚙️ How Abi Works

Abi combines multiple technologies:

1. Conversational AI

  • Natural conversations
  • Context awareness
  • Personalized responses

2. Behavioral Monitoring

  • Tracks routines
  • Detects unusual patterns
  • Alerts caregivers if needed

3. Smart Reminders

  • Medication alerts
  • Appointment tracking
  • Daily activity prompts

4. Emotional Interaction

  • Responds to tone and mood
  • Encourages conversation
  • Provides companionship

👉 It’s not just functional—it’s designed to feel present.

2. The Ethics of Artificial Companionship

Big question:

👉 Is it okay for machines to simulate care?

Concerns include:

  • Emotional dependency
  • Replacement of human interaction
  • Authenticity of relationships

4. Data Privacy Risks

Abi collects sensitive data:

  • Health information
  • Behavior patterns

👉 This raises concerns about:

  • Data security
  • Misuse
  • Surveillance

5. Accessibility and Cost Barriers

Advanced care robots may:

  • Be expensive
  • Limited to wealthier users

👉 This could widen inequality in elder care.
